The housing market in St. James, MO is relatively strong despite having a median house value of $115,600, which is significantly lower than the US median house value of $338,100. Despite this discrepancy, the area has seen an impressive one-year appreciation rate of 13.45%, which is 5.18% higher than the national average of 8.27%. This is indicative of a hot local housing market that offers potential buyers good value for their money and should be considered by anyone looking to purchase a home in the St. James area.

The median home cost in St. James is $115,600.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 73.2%. Home Appreciation in St. James is up 17.1%.
